Charlotte Hope is the founder of Hope Wildlife Consulting. She has over 35 years of experience in monitoring, managing, and recovering protected species through her position as a wildlife biologist for the South Carolina Department of Natural Resources (SC DNR).
Charlotte has been monitoring South Carolina’s bald eagle population since 1985 and has worked extensively on the recovery of the loggerhead sea turtle throughout her career. She has spent hundreds of hours doing aerial surveys of eagles from fixed-wing planes and 6,000 hours of bald eagle observation from the ground.
Charlotte has also worked with the Coast Guard, utility companies, and cell phone carriers to help them maintain their equipment while protecting ospreys during their nesting season. Charlotte has helped landowners use their land while following the Endangered Species Act, Bald and Golden Eagle Act, and Migratory Bird Treaty Act regulations.
Outside of her work with raptors, Charlotte has experience with American alligators, marine mammals, wood storks, gopher tortoises, and wading, shore, and sea birds.
